## Step 4: Vendor third-party fonts

As of Larkspur 3.1, fonts are no longer fetched at build time from the Glyphhaven mirror. Copy the licensed font files into assets/vendor/fonts and commit them directly; the pipeline verifies checksums on every build. Remove any leftover fetch hooks from older branches, since they will fail silently. Once the files are in place, update the service to use the following configuration values:

settings of fafog-haduf:
ZORIX_PIN=4648
ZORIX_METRICS_HOST=metrics.zorix.paliqsys.corp
ZORIX_LOG_LEVEL=info
ZORIX_TENANT=druix

Visitor Policy — Spare Hardware Store (Room 4.12). Team assistants may escort visitors to the spare-hardware storage room only for the purpose of collecting pre-approved equipment listed on a signed release form. Visitors must remain within sight at all times, and no items may leave the room without being logged in the asset register kept on the shelf by the door. The room remains locked outside these visits; authorised assistants may open it using the code below.

staff pass of kawep-hahap = bdg-IEUUF-6

ALERT: StockMerge reconciliation job failed

The nightly StockMerge run on the Copperfield cluster exited nonzero. Usually caused by a stale warehouse snapshot or a locked ledger table. Do not rerun blindly; duplicate adjustments will post to the Driftwood ledger. Check the last snapshot timestamp first, then requeue with the safe flag. Full runbook with step-by-step recovery is here:

operations page: https://jenkins.zemvarcloud.local/job/merge_requests/repo/build/73930b4b30f0a8ed

Handover for the Liftrail dispatch simulator. The core tick loop lives in the scheduler module; do not change the tick interval without rerunning the full scenario suite, as morning-rush results are sensitive to it. Passenger arrival distributions are configured per building profile, and the Carrowgate tower profile is the canonical benchmark. Known issue: idle cars occasionally oscillate between floors six and seven; a proposed damping fix is drafted but unreviewed. For design history and open questions, contact the engineer named below.

named custodian: Fraion Holael